Visiting contractors using the Thornbeck Park shuttle must enter through the east shuttle-bus gate, not the main lobby. The gate is staffed until 9 a.m.; after that it is reader-controlled and contractor passes will not open it. Wait for your site contact, or if pre-authorised on the Arbourline works list, enter using the contractor gate code below.

badge for yagag-bahip: bdg-Z-31

## Runbook: Widediff Large-File Viewer

When reviewers report timeouts on diffs over 40 MB, first confirm the chunked-render worker is enabled via `WIDEDIFF_CHUNKED=true`. Next, verify the blob cache is reachable; a cold cache forces full re-parsing and will reproduce the symptom. The worker authenticates to the cache tier on boot, and the env file must therefore contain this line.

secret setting of yajog-taguf: ARCHIVE_KEY3=051

If the Gildhall seat-map renderer starts serving blank sections, first check the Rowanmoor cache tier — stale venue layouts are the usual cause. Flush the layout cache, then restart the renderer pods one at a time to avoid dropping active booking sessions. Escalate to the Stagelight team only if rows render out of order after the flush. The renderer reads its runtime settings from the block below.

deployment values, yadug-bawif:
[framir]
team = pelox
access_code = ac_a38ab2
owner = tamion.julael
host = framir.tolvaqlabs.test
port = 11211
peer = tammir.zemvargrid.local
salt = 2215ef03
pin = 1541

Ticket: The slimmed container image for the Orvexa billing worker fails health checks in staging. Removing the locale packages during the image-diet pass appears to break currency formatting, causing the readiness probe to reject startup. Full-size images work fine. Support should advise affected teams to pin the previous image until the fix lands. For escalations, cite the image build that reproduces the failure, noted below.

session token of yahof-bajeg = htk9_0d43d44ed